On July 27,2017,Intermountain Gas Company asked the Commission for authority
to implement a Demand Side Management (DSM)Program Funding Mechanism and DSM
Charge.Although the Commission has yet to formally accept a tariff filing from the Company,a
draft tariff was submitted as an exhibit during the Company’s recent rate case,in which the
Commission authorized the Company to implement a residential DSM program,but did not
approve the proposed fixed cost collection mechanism.Order No.33757 at 37-38.
Intermountain asks that its Application be processed by Modified Procedure,and requests an
effective date of October 1,2017,to coincide with the requested effective date for its annual
Purchased Gas Cost Adjustment filing.
NOTICE OF APPLICATION
YOU ARE HEREBY NOTIFIED that “DSM”generally refers to utility activities and
programs that encourage customers (thus,on the “demand side”as opposed to the “generation
side”)to use less overall energy or use less energy during peak usage hours.Order No.33188.
The Commission authorized the Company to implement a DSM program,finding that “DSM,as
both a least-cost resource and an important element of promoting energy efficiency,is an
important part of any utility’s provision of service.”Order No.33757 at 37;see Application at 2.
However,the Commission rejected the Company’s proposal to use a fixed cost collection
mechanism (FCCM),citing insufficient “evidentiary quantification of the Company’s need for an
FCCM and the benefits of its developing DSM program,and what it hopes to achieve through
energy efficiency programs and fixed-cost recovery.”Order No.33757 at 38.
YOU ARE FURTHER NOTIFIED that the Company seeks “to define and formalize
a mechanism whereby the Company can recover costs incurred in the administration and

delivery of its Rate Schedule DSM”and submits a proposed budget for recovery.Application at
3.The Company states that its costs from administering its DSM program may include energy
efficiency program rebates:administration ramp-up expenses and incremental staffing;DSM
outreach;local support for promotion of tariff-approved DSM measures;and encouraging market
transformation through adaptation of energy efficiency technologies.Id.The Company reports
that all DSM activities are designed for its residential customers.Id.
YOU ARE FURTHER NOTIFIED that the Company proposes a recovery mechanism
in which it submits its “annual budget of anticipated administrative and program costs related to
the Company’s DSM program.”Id.In its annual filing,the Company will request the
Commission’s ruling that its “expenses are both reasonable and prudent.”Id.Also,the
Company’s budget will include “any surplus or deficit associated with the collection of DSM
funds and the incurrence of DSM-related expenses.”Id.
YOU ARE FURTHER NOTIFIED that the Company states its “DSM Charge shall be
determined as the approved annual budget to implement Rate Schedule DSM divided by
normalized therm sales for Rate Schedule RS,as determined in the Company’s annual Purchased
Gas Cost Adjustment filing.”Id.“All DSM funds collected will be allocated to costs incurred in
the administration and delivery of its proposed DSM program,and accounting records will be
maintained to track actual expenses vs.the DSM Charge collected from residential customers.”
Id.at4.
YOU ARE FURTI-IER NOTIFIED that,for the program year October 1,2017 to
September 30,2018,the Company estimates costs of $177,000 for program delivery and
administration (personnel and ramp-up expenses),and $600,000 in rebate payments for total
costs of $777,000.Id.This proposed budget would equal a per therm increase of $000367
(0.58%)for the Company’s residential class.Id.

YOU ARE FURTHER NOTIFIED that the Commission has determined that the
public interest may not require a formal hearing in this matter and will proceed under Modified
Procedure pursuant to Rules 201 through 204 of the Idaho Public Utilities Commission’s Rules
of Procedure,IDAPA 31.01.01.201-.204.The Commission notes that Modified Procedure and
written comments have proven to be an effective means for obtaining public input and
participation.
